Murtadha Hubail has submitted this change and it was merged.
Change subject: [NO ISSUE][BAD] Coordinated Change for Multi-Statement
......................................................................
[NO ISSUE][BAD] Coordinated Change for Multi-Statement
Change-Id: I94acfecbf5aaa21ab103173dd2a8ab89080461e0
---
M
asterix-bad/src/main/java/org/apache/asterix/bad/lang/BADStatementExecutor.java
M
asterix-bad/src/main/java/org/apache/asterix/bad/recovery/BADGlobalRecoveryManager.java
2 files changed, 4 insertions(+), 3 deletions(-)
Approvals:
Till Westmann: Looks good to me, approved
Jenkins: Verified
Murtadha Hubail: Looks good to me, but someone else must approve
diff --git
a/asterix-bad/src/main/java/org/apache/asterix/bad/lang/BADStatementExecutor.java
b/asterix-bad/src/main/java/org/apache/asterix/bad/lang/BADStatementExecutor.java
index 3ea2c0d..b95ca11 100644
---
a/asterix-bad/src/main/java/org/apache/asterix/bad/lang/BADStatementExecutor.java
+++
b/asterix-bad/src/main/java/org/apache/asterix/bad/lang/BADStatementExecutor.java
@@ -334,7 +334,8 @@
}
}
}
- final IRequestParameters requestParameters = new
RequestParameters(null, null, null, null, null, null, null);
+ final IRequestParameters requestParameters =
+ new RequestParameters(null, null, null, null, null, null,
null, true);
for (Channel channel : channels) {
if
(!channel.getChannelId().getDataverse().equals(dvId.getValue())) {
continue;
diff --git
a/asterix-bad/src/main/java/org/apache/asterix/bad/recovery/BADGlobalRecoveryManager.java
b/asterix-bad/src/main/java/org/apache/asterix/bad/recovery/BADGlobalRecoveryManager.java
index 89d940e..f358986 100644
---
a/asterix-bad/src/main/java/org/apache/asterix/bad/recovery/BADGlobalRecoveryManager.java
+++
b/asterix-bad/src/main/java/org/apache/asterix/bad/recovery/BADGlobalRecoveryManager.java
@@ -122,7 +122,7 @@
listener.suspend();
activeEventHandler.registerListener(listener);
BADJobService.redeployJobSpec(entityId, channel.getChannelBody(),
metadataProvider, badStatementExecutor,
- hcc, new RequestParameters(null, null, null, null, null,
null, null), true);
+ hcc, new RequestParameters(null, null, null, null, null,
null, null, true), true);
ScheduledExecutorService ses =
BADJobService.startRepetitiveDeployedJobSpec(listener.getDeployedJobSpecId(),
hcc,
@@ -149,7 +149,7 @@
new HyracksDataset(hcc,
appCtx.getCompilerProperties().getFrameSize(),
ResultReader.NUM_READERS),
new
ResultProperties(IStatementExecutor.ResultDelivery.IMMEDIATE),
- new IStatementExecutor.Stats(), null, null, null,
null),
+ new IStatementExecutor.Stats(), null, null, null,
null, true),
true);
metadataProvider.getLocks().unlock();
//Log that the procedure stopped by cluster restart. Procedure is
available again now.
--
To view, visit https://asterix-gerrit.ics.uci.edu/2737
To unsubscribe, visit https://asterix-gerrit.ics.uci.edu/settings
Gerrit-MessageType: merged
Gerrit-Change-Id: I94acfecbf5aaa21ab103173dd2a8ab89080461e0
Gerrit-PatchSet: 3
Gerrit-Project: asterixdb-bad
Gerrit-Branch: master
Gerrit-Owner: Murtadha Hubail <[email protected]>
Gerrit-Reviewer: Jenkins <[email protected]>
Gerrit-Reviewer: Murtadha Hubail <[email protected]>
Gerrit-Reviewer: Till Westmann <[email protected]>